Runbook 4.2 — Permit blueprint transfers. When stamped blueprints for a building permit are returned from the drafting contractor, they are to be logged in the document register and stored in a rigid tube, never folded. For the current Aldenmoor project, the approved set must reach the Caverly municipal permit counter within two business days of receipt. Office manager signs the release form before any run is booked, and the tube is sealed with tamper tape. The courier hand-over instruction is set out immediately below.

handover note for kajop-yawep: the ulair jorox courier leaves the belax ledger at gate 9133 under passcode 401596

## Telemetry Gateway Basics

The Furrowline gateway aggregates sensor data from harvesters and irrigation rigs before forwarding it to the Cropmesh backend. As release manager, be aware that gateway firmware and backend schema versions must be released in lockstep; a mismatch causes silent field drops rather than hard failures, which makes regressions hard to spot in staging. Always confirm the compatibility matrix before cutting a release, and hold the rollout if any row is marked pending. The matrix is maintained on the internal page.

wiki page, baguf-kagaf: https://artifactory.zarqeldata.example/pipeline/view/settings/merge_requests/pipeline/dash/secrets/98ab582f1728a97551123f76

Handover note — payroll export change (Ledgerly v4), for support awareness. Tomas is taking this over from me. As of the March cycle, exports moved from XML to line-delimited JSON; filenames now carry a cycle suffix. Customers on the legacy Fernhollow integration will see a one-time re-import prompt — this is expected, please reassure them. Known gap: retroactive bonus lines can appear duplicated until the dedupe patch ships next sprint; workaround is a manual re-export. Step-by-step support guidance, with sample files, is on the internal page.

runbook for badug-kadup: https://confluence.zemvarlabs.internal/projects/browse/display/projects/bd1b